Position
Alexander Jolles is a Partner in Schellenberg Wittmer's Dispute Resolution and Private Wealth Group and heads the Art and Entertainment Group in Zurich. His main areas of practice include domestic and international litigation and arbitration as well as succession, trust and estate planning and litigation.
In addition, Alexander Jolles has a longstanding and extensive practice in the field of art and entertainment. He advises a broad range of clients from auction houses, galleries and dealers to museums, private collectors, artists and artist estates. He regularly advises on matters ranging from the sale and purchase of fine art; to title disputes; looted, stolen, forged and damaged art; shipping, import and export of art; structuring and managing of collections, foundations, loans, bequests and donations; attribution and authentication of art; art insurance; art as collateral; art funds; copyrights.
Experience
- Extensive experience in inheritance matters, estate and succession planning, complex trust and estate disputes, and in art law, including art-related litigation
- Serving both as arbitrator and as counsel to parties before arbitration tribunals, state courts, and regulatory authorities
Career
Member of the Management Committee of Schellenberg Wittmer (2009-2015); Secretary General of the Claims Resolution Tribunal for Dormant Accounts in Switzerland (1999-2001); Partner at Schellenberg Wittmer (1998); Associate at Schellenberg Wittmer (1991); Foreign Associate at two law firms in the U.S. (1989)
